Karasuk, Russia: Climate and Weather Year Round

Karasuk is a city located in the Novosibirsk Oblast region of Russia. It is situated in the southwestern part of Siberia and is known for its unique climate and weather conditions throughout the year. In this article, we will delve into the details of Karasuk's climate, including temperature ranges, precipitation levels, and seasonal variations.

Climate Classification

Karasuk falls under the continental climate classification, specifically the subarctic climate (Dfc) according to the Köppen climate classification system. This type of climate is characterized by long, cold winters and short, warm summers.

Temperature

The temperature in Karasuk shows a significant variation between seasons. Winters are exceptionally cold, with average temperatures ranging from -20°C (-4°F) to -30°C (-22°F). Extreme cold waves can push temperatures even lower, reaching below -40°C (-40°F) at times. The coldest months are December, January, and February. Summer months, on the other hand, experience relatively milder temperatures. Average temperatures during this season range from 15°C (59°F) to 25°C (77°F). July and August are the warmest months, with temperatures occasionally climbing above 30°C (86°F).

Precipitation

Karasuk receives a moderate amount of precipitation throughout the year, with the highest levels occurring during the summer months. The city experiences an average of 500-600 millimeters (20-24 inches) of precipitation annually. The most rainfall occurs in July, followed by June and August. During the winter months, precipitation mainly occurs in the form of snow. The snow cover can reach significant depths, with an average of 30-40 centimeters (12-16 inches) in January and February. Snowfall can persist from November until April, contributing to the city's picturesque winter scenery.

Seasonal Variations

Spring (March to May) in Karasuk is characterized by a gradual transition from the cold winter. The temperatures start to rise, and the snow begins to melt, giving way to the emergence of vibrant greenery and blooming flowers. Summer (June to August) is the warmest and most pleasant season in Karasuk. The temperatures are mild to warm, and the city experiences long daylight hours. This period is ideal for outdoor activities and exploring the surrounding natural landscapes. Autumn (September to November) brings cooler temperatures and a beautiful display of fall foliage. The transition from summer to winter is accompanied by a decrease in daylight hours and an increase in rainfall. Winter (December to February) is the coldest season in Karasuk. The city is covered in a thick blanket of snow, and freezing temperatures prevail. Despite the cold, the snowy landscapes create a picturesque and serene atmosphere.

Extreme Weather Events

Karasuk, being situated in a continental climate zone, is prone to extreme weather events. Blizzards and snowstorms are common during the winter months, often leading to disruptions in transportation and daily life. These weather events can cause low visibility and create hazardous road conditions. During the summer, thunderstorms occasionally occur, accompanied by heavy rainfall, lightning, and strong winds. While these events are not as severe as the winter storms, they can still pose some risks.
